They're laughing at them, not with them

Saturday Night Live is back, with a vengeance. Tina Fey did Sarah Palin and Amy Poehler did Hillary Clinton, and both were right on target:
The show's season premiere opened with a 'nonpartisan message' where the two pleaded for an end to sexism in presidential campaigns. As Poehler's Clinton bragged about her foreign policy experience, Fey's Palin exclaimed: "I can see Russia from my house!" Poehler wrapped up the sketch this way: "In conclusion, I invite the media to grow a pair. And if you can't, I will lend you mine."
